Как подключить Android к OBD2: мониторинг и диагностика автомобиля

Введение
Android‑устройства отлично работают как мобильные мини‑компьютеры в автомобиле. Помимо навигации и мультимедиа, их можно использовать для мониторинга состояния машины и диагностики неисправностей через порт OBD2. Это даёт возможность понять проблему ещё до визита в сервис и, возможно, сэкономить на ремонте.
Краткое определение терминов:
- OBD2 — стандартизированный разъём и протоколы обмена диагностической информацией в современных автомобилях.
- ELM327 — популярная микросхема/стандарт интерфейса для OBD2‑адаптеров, обеспечивающий совместимость с множеством приложений.
- ECU — электронный блок управления (Engine Control Unit), который хранит и передаёт параметры и коды ошибок.
Выбор подходящего OBD2‑адаптера
Есть два типа бытовых OBD2‑адаптеров: с проводным USB‑интерфейсом и беспроводные — Bluetooth или Wi‑Fi. Для Android предпочтительнее Bluetooth или Wi‑Fi, так как большинство приложений поддерживают именно эти подключения. USB‑адаптеры нередко требуют специальных драйверов или не поддерживаются мобильными приложениями.
Где искать разъём: обычно под приборной панелью со стороны водителя или между передними сиденьями, рядом с рычагом переключения передач. Приложение «OBD Port Lookup» или руководство по эксплуатации автомобиля помогут найти порт.
Важно:
- Проверьте совместимость адаптера с конкретной моделью автомобиля. Некоторые адаптеры не поддерживают редкие протоколы.
- Читайте отзывы, уточняйте у продавца наличие оригинального чипа ELM327 и совместимость с Android.
- Избегайте дешёвых клонированных адаптеров с плохо реализованным Bluetooth, если вам нужна стабильность.
Рекомендация по типу: Bluetooth‑адаптеры ELM327 совместимы с большинством Android‑приложений. Некоторые устройства также поддерживают Wi‑Fi подключение — оно может быть быстрее, но требует настройки сети.
Диагностика неисправностей через OBD2
OBD2‑адаптер передаёт коды ошибок (DTC — Diagnostic Trouble Codes). При подключении приложение считывает эти коды и сопоставляет их с внутренней базой знаний, показывая вероятную причину. Это особенно полезно для предварительной оценки перед ремонтом.
Примечание: многие современные узлы автомобиля не подлежат ремонту — их меняют целиком. Диагностика даёт направление: какой модуль или датчик следует проверять/менять.
Советы при диагностике:
- Убедитесь, что приложение и адаптер совместимы с протоколом вашего автомобиля.
- Перед считыванием кодов заглушите двигатель и повторно включите зажигание, если приложение просит это сделать.
- После ремонта сбросьте коды и проведите тест‑поездку, чтобы проверить, вернулась ли ошибка.
Приложения для мониторинга и диагностики
Выбор приложения — важная часть. Много приложений заявляют о поддержке OBD2, но далеко не все работают корректно со всеми адаптерами или автомобилями. Ниже — два надёжных варианта, которые хорошо себя зарекомендовали.
ScanMaster Lite
ScanMaster Lite — бесплатное приложение для начала работы. Оно поддерживает разные интерфейсы OBD2 и позволяет:
- читать и сбрасывать DTC;
- отображать потоковые данные (живые значения): обороты двигателя (RPM), скорость, температура и др.;
- выбирать разные электронные блоки управления (ECU), если их несколько.
ScanMaster полезен, если у автомобиля несколько ECU, и нужно переключаться между ними.
DashCommand
DashCommand предлагает более наглядный интерфейс и графики. Приложение распространяется как пробная версия с ограничением времени подключения к OBD2, после чего нужно купить полную версию.
Особенности DashCommand:
- наглядные приборные панели и графики расхода топлива;
- функции GPS‑аналитики для оценки расхода на маршруте;
- расширенные средства визуализации параметров.
Когда система не срабатывает: типичные причины и контрпример
Иногда OBD2‑подключение оказывается бесполезным. Вот самые частые причины:
- Адаптер не поддерживает нужный протокол автомобиля (например, устаревший или редкий протокол). Тогда ни одно приложение не сможет прочитать данные.
- Плохое качество Bluetooth‑чипа у дешёвого адаптера: связь нестабильна, пакеты теряются.
- Аппаратный дефект ECU: блок не отвечает на запросы, коды не выдаются.
- Автомобиль старше 1996 года (в некоторых регионах стандарты OBD2 ещё не обязательны), порт может отсутствовать.
Контрпример: если у вас современный автомобиль с поддержкой стандартного OBD2 и адаптер с оригинальным ELM327, но приложение постоянно теряет соединение — проблема чаще всего в адаптере (плохой клон) или в настройках энергосбережения телефона.
Альтернативные подходы
- Профессиональные сканеры: если вам нужна глубокая диагностика (прошивка модулей, программирование ключей), используйте профессиональный сканер в сервисе.
- Подключение к ноутбуку: некоторые адаптеры позволяют подключать OBD2 к Windows‑ПК — полезно для детального логирования.
- Wi‑Fi адаптеры: подходят, когда предпочтительнее стабильность соединения или нужно несколько устройств одновременно.
- Сервисы и облачные платформы: некоторые платные платформы хранят телеметрию и строят отчёты по пробегу и расходу топлива для автопарков.
Практическая методика выбора и проверки (мини‑методология)
- Определите цель: мониторинг в реальном времени, периодическая диагностика или редкая проверка ошибок.
- Найдите разъём OBD2 в автомобиле и проверьте, есть ли питание на порту (+12 В при включённом зажигании).
- Выберите адаптер: Bluetooth (универсально) или Wi‑Fi (для стабильности и нескольких устройств).
- Проверьте отзывы о совместимости с вашей моделью автомобиля и с приложением, которое вы планируете использовать.
- Купите адаптер известного бренда или с подтверждением оригинальности ELM327.
- Скачайте бесплатную версию приложения (ScanMaster Lite) и протестируйте соединение.
- Считайте коды ошибок, проведите тест‑поездку, при необходимости обратитесь к специалисту.
Таблица совместимости — краткая справка
| Тип адаптера | Android | Windows | Подходит для | Примечание |
|---|---|---|---|---|
| Bluetooth ELM327 | Да | При наличии адаптера Bluetooth | Большинство OBD2‑автомобилей | Универсальное и простое в использовании |
| Wi‑Fi ELM327 | Да | Да | Когда нужно подключение нескольких устройств | Требует настройки Wi‑Fi сети |
| USB OBD2 | Нет/Ограниченно | Да | Работа с ноутбуком | Требует OTG и драйверов, редко поддерживается мобильными приложениями |
Ролевые чек‑листы
Для водителя:
- Убедиться, что адаптер правильно входит в OBD2‑разъём.
- Не оставлять адаптер постоянно включённым, чтобы избежать разряда батареи.
- Снимать коды и смотреть описание ошибки перед поездкой в сервис.
Для DIY‑механика:
- Использовать приложение с логированием параметров в файл.
- Проверять живые данные во время тест‑прогонов.
- Сбросить коды после ремонта и убедиться, что ошибка не вернулась.
Для автосервиса/механика:
- Использовать сертифицированный адаптер или профессиональный сканер.
- Хранить базу частых DTC и процедур по устранению.
- Предоставлять клиенту расшифровку кода и рекомендации по ремонту.
Критерии приёмки
- Устройство успешно подключается к Android‑смартфону (Bluetooth или Wi‑Fi).
- Приложение считывает идентификатор ECU и показывает минимум RPM и скорость.
- При вызове чтения DTC приложение возвращает коды ошибок, которые можно расшифровать.
- После сброса кодов при тест‑поездке контрольная лампа неисправности не загорается повторно (если проблема решена).
Простые тесты и сценарии приёмки
- Тест 1: Подключение — адаптер виден в настройках Bluetooth и успешно сопряжён.
- Тест 2: Живые данные — при запуске двигателя приложение показывает RPM и температуру.
- Тест 3: Считывание DTC — при наличии активной ошибки приложение возвращает код.
- Тест 4: Сброс DTC — после исправления ошибки код успешно сбрасывается и не появляется снова.
Глоссарий — 1‑строчные определения
- DTC: диагностический код неисправности, который хранится в ECU.
- ELM327: широко используемый интерфейс OBD2 для обмена данными по Bluetooth/Wi‑Fi.
- ECU: электронный блок управления автомобилем.
Безопасность и приватность
- Не храните личные данные в облаке приложения, если не доверяете сервису.
- Отключайте адаптер от порта OBD2 при длительном простое транспортного средства, чтобы не разряжать аккумулятор.
- При передаче логов сервиса удаляйте персональные координаты (если лог содержит GPS‑метки).
Когда лучше обратиться в сервис
- Если код ошибки указывает на критический элемент безопасности (тормоза, подушки безопасности).
- Если проблема связана с программированием блоков управления или иммобилайзером.
- Когда диагностика требует специализированного оборудования и опыта.
Вывод и рекомендации
Использование Android + OBD2 — это доступный и удобный путь получать телеметрию и предварительную диагностику автомобиля. Для большинства пользователей оптимально:
- взять Bluetooth ELM327‑адаптер от проверенного продавца;
- начать с бесплатного ScanMaster Lite для проверки совместимости;
- при необходимости инвестировать в DashCommand или профессиональный инструмент.
Со временем такие решения помогают экономить на простых ремонтах и дают лучшее понимание состояния машины.
Социальная заметка: какие приложения и адаптеры пробовали вы? Поделитесь опытом в комментариях.
Автор изображения: крупный план мужчины у сломанной машины со смартфоном (Shutterstock), изображение OBDII портa — M.M.Minderhoud.
Похожие материалы
Как исправить чёрный экран на Roku TV
Установка и настройка NordVPN на ПК и мобильных
Добавить выпадающий список в Google Таблицы
Подключить Nest Thermostat к Apple Home через Matter
Сброс Google Nest Hub до заводских настроек